At Hinckley (Leics) Train Station, you'll find a ticket office that is operational from 6:40 AM to 1:00 PM from Monday to Saturday, although it's closed on Sundays. For those purchasing tickets online, the collection is available at the station through accessible ticket machines. However, it's important to note that these machines are not equipped for smartcard issuance. They do, however, validate smartcards for your convenience.
Accessibility is partially facilitated with step-free access to certain areas, including Platform 1 via a short ramp and Platform 2 via a ramped bridge. For assistance, staff are available during ticket office hours, and help points are scattered throughout the station. Although the station lacks some amenities such as ATM machines, refreshment facilities, or public Wi-Fi, there is CCTV to ensure security.
For those wondering about travel linkage from Hinckley, the station is well-equipped with various options to suit your journey requirements. Rail replacement services are conveniently located just outside the station in the unfortunate event of disruptions. Taxis are also readily available, with contact numbers including Station Taxis at 01455 614444 and Orion Taxis at 01455 612164. Coulsdon South Station is equipped with a variety of facilities to make your journey comfortable and hassle-free. With a well-stocked ticket office open from early morning until late evening, purchasing and collecting tickets becomes a breeze. In addition to manned ticket windows, multiple ticket machines are available to cater to those in a rush or preferring self-service options. These machines are also accessible for everyone, including features that acc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.
The station prides itself on its commitment to accessibility. Lifts provide step-free access to all platforms, ensuring that everyone, irrespective of their mobility needs, can enjoy easy navigation across the station. Staff are present to provide assistance from early morning until late into the night. Meanwhile, customer help points are strategically located on platforms, offering timely assistance at all hours.
While there isn’t a dedicated waiting room, there are seating areas available for passengers awaiting their trains. Refreshments are available, although it lacks full-fledged dining or shopping facilities. However, clean sanitary facilities are provided, with toilets on Platform 1 and in the ticket hall ensuring travelers can freshen up before boarding. Additionally, pay phones on the premises cater to travelers needing to make last-minute calls.
Reaching Coulsdon South Station and moving beyond is conveniently connected through various transport links. A taxi rank sits just outside the station entrance, ready to whisk you off to your next destination. Bus links can also be planned through helpful resources available at the station. Should you encounter disruptions, a rail replacement service is efficiently in place to ensure that your journey remains as uninterrupted as possible.
